The cheapest way to get from Sha Tin to Peng Chau is to line 182 bus and ferry which costs $35 - $55 and takes 1h 40m.
The fastest way to get from Sha Tin to Peng Chau is to subway and ferry which takes 1h 28m and costs $50 - $60.
The distance between Sha Tin and Peng Chau is 37 km.
The best way to get from Sha Tin to Peng Chau without a car is to subway and ferry which takes 1h 28m and costs $50 - $60.
It takes approximately 1h 28m to get from Sha Tin to Peng Chau, including transfers.

There is no direct connection from Sha Tin to Peng Chau. However, you can take the subway to Admiralty, walk to [Ctb] Admiralty - High Court, Queensway|[Kmb+Ctb] High Court/<Br>Admiralty - High Court, Queensway|[Kmb] High Court, take the line 11 bus to Central Ferry Bus Terminus, walk to Central Pier No. 6 at Man Kwong Street(Western Berth)|Central Pier No. 6 at Man Kwong Street(Eastern Berth), then take the ferry to Peng Chau Ferry Pier at Lo Peng Street. Alternatively, you can take a bus from [Kmb] Tai Wai Bbi - Chik Wan Street|[Lwb] Tai Wai Bbi - Chik Wan Street to Peng Chau Public Pier at Lo Peng Street|Peng Chau Public Pier via Hong Kong International Airport Bus Terminal, Siena Two, Capevale Drive, and Nim Shue Wan Landing Steps at Marina Drive, Lantau Island|Nim Shue Wan Landing Steps, Discovery Bay in around 1h 45m.
